HTC 7 Mozart vs Nokia E72
Here you can compare HTC 7 Mozart and Nokia E72. Comparing HTC 7 Mozart vs Nokia E72 on Smartprix enables you to check their respective specs scores and unique features. It would potentially help you understand how HTC 7 Mozart stands against Nokia E72 and which one should you buy The current lowest price found for HTC 7 Mozart is ₹24,254 and for Nokia E72 is ₹1,200. The details of both of these products were last updated on Apr 26, 2024.
Specification | HTC 7 Mozart | Nokia E72 |
---|---|---|
OS | Windows Phone v7 | Symbian v9.3 |
CPU | 1 GHz, Single Core Processor | 600 MHz, Single Core Processor |
Internal Memory | 8 GB | 250 MB |
Rear Camera | 8 MP with autofocus | 5 MP with autofocus |
Display | 3.7 inches, 480 x 800 pixels | 2.4 inches, 320 x 240 pixels |
Price | ₹24,254 | ₹1,200 |
